We screen patients at the bedside and assist in forming a safe dc plan. They may need rehab, nursing home placement, may have to work on getting authorization for those services, medical equipment. We work as an interdisciplinary team with doctor, PT/OT, caregivers, nursing.

Utilization has a lot of insurance rules. At my facility if you’ve never done it before remote work is possible after training. They will make sure you can work independently before they turn you loose. It is possible though.
